Effective Integration of Technology in the Classroom

Effective integration of technology in the classroom can have numerous benefits, including increased engagement, improved learning outcomes, and enhanced student achievement. However, simply incorporating technology into a lesson plan is not enough to ensure success. Teachers must carefully consider how technology can best support their instructional goals and student needs.

SAMR Model

One effective approach to integrating technology in the classroom is to use a framework such as the SAMR model. This model encourages teachers to move beyond simply substituting technology for traditional teaching methods and instead focus on redefining learning tasks to take full advantage of technology's capabilities. For example, instead of having students read a passage from a textbook, they could use a digital tool to create and share multimedia presentations on the topic.

Digital Literacy

Another important consideration when integrating technology in the classroom is to ensure that students have the necessary skills and access to technology. Teachers may need to provide instruction on digital literacy and provide access to devices and software. It is also important to consider issues of equity and access, as not all students may have equal access to technology outside of the classroom.

Assessment and Evaluation

Finally, effective integration of technology in the classroom requires ongoing assessment and evaluation. Teachers should regularly evaluate the impact of technology on student learning outcomes and adjust their approach as needed. This can involve collecting and analyzing data on student performance, soliciting feedback from students, and reflecting on their own teaching practices.
